I mean a lot would depend on the type of virus in question, but generally deleting infected files would likely be the way to go. Some viruses can infect other files which could make this slightly tricky. Looking around Task Manager for any suspicious processes and following their source could help. Chance are that if she is unaware of the free options she would likely be unaware of how to do this too.
Depending on the operating system, there are some in-built features that help with this (they might not really do that, sometimes but it's still worth a try). In Win10 there's Windows Defender for an example. While paid versions of software might provide better results, the free options are not insufficient in most cases.
Malwarebytes and any other free anti-virus (just google 'free anti-virus list') would most likely solve the issue, but again depending on the virus in question they might not. Worst case scenario your friend could always try re-installing the operating system which most likely would fix it. Again, there's many unknowns as to whatever she is using and what sort of virus it is.
